Technical Breakthroughs
Avaru's proprietary Lithium Ferro-Phosphate (LFP) technology offers:
- 6,000+ charge cycles (2x industry average)
- Modular design from 5kWh to 50kWh
- -20°C to 60°C operational range

FAQ
- Q: How does warranty work? A: 10-year performance guarantee with optional extended coverage
- Q: Maintenance requirements? A: Fully sealed units require only annual visual inspection
- Q: Installation timeframe? A: Typical residential setup completes in 1-2 business days
